What reviewers say

Sourced tester consensus for each — the "what people who used it think" layer, not just specs.

Jarvis Adjustable Height Desk (Laminate)

Two whitelisted hands-on testers (TechRadar, Tom's Guide) both rate the Jarvis a well-built, quiet, high-capacity (350 lb) standing desk with broad size and customization options; TechRadar adds a long warranty (15 years on components, 5 on the desktop). Both reviewed the Bamboo-top configuration of the same Jarvis frame, not the Laminate top under review, so surface-finish impressions do not transfer. Caveats: price (TechRadar), slight leg wobble at max height (TechRadar), and slower assembly than some rivals (Tom's Guide). (2 sourced reviews, 2 lab-tested.)

Praised: Quiet, smooth up/down operation across its range; High weight capacity (350 lb) and sturdy build; Wide range of sizes and customization options.

Flagged: Expensive versus some rival desks; Slight leg wobble at maximum standing height; Slower / harder to assemble than some competitors.

Autonomous Desk Core

Two whitelisted hands-on testers cover the exact Autonomous SmartDesk Core, both qualitatively with no lab measurements. Reviewed (USA Today) names it Best Value and praises its sleek, high-tech design and shake-free height changes; Real Homes praises its sturdiness (250 lb hold) and quiet, discreet operation. Both note real drawbacks: Reviewed flags heavy, difficult two-person assembly with an unclear first step, while Real Homes flags poor cable management, a high price, and that it isn't truly 'smart' (no USB ports or wireless charging). (2 sourced reviews.)

Praised: Sturdy and shake-free when adjusting height; Sleek, high-tech design with multiple finish and color options; Quiet operation when raising or lowering.

Flagged: Heavy and difficult to set up (two-person job), with an unclear first assembly step; Not truly 'smart' — no USB ports or wireless charging; Poor built-in cable management; wires dangle in standing mode.
